审查网页缓存,获取标题信息
查看网页缓存文件

首页 2024-09-09 04:56:09



在数字化时代,网页缓存文件作为提升用户体验、优化网络加载速度及减轻服务器压力的关键技术之一,其重要性不言而喻

    深入了解并正确查看网页缓存文件,对于网站开发者、运维人员乃至内容创作者而言,都是一项不可或缺的技能

    本文将从专业角度出发,深入探讨如何高效、准确地查看网页缓存文件,以及这一过程中蕴含的策略与价值

     引言:网页缓存的基石作用 网页缓存,简而言之,是浏览器或中间服务器(如CDN)存储的网页副本,以便在后续请求时能够迅速响应,减少从原始服务器加载数据的时间

    这一过程不仅加快了网页加载速度,还减轻了原始服务器的负担,对于提升网站整体性能和用户体验至关重要

     为何需要查看网页缓存文件 1.性能调优:通过分析缓存文件,可以识别哪些资源被频繁访问,进而优化这些资源的加载策略,比如压缩图片、合并JS/CSS文件等

     2.故障排查:当网页内容更新后用户仍看到旧内容时,查看缓存文件可以帮助定位问题是否由缓存未更新导致

     3.内容一致性检查:确保不同用户、不同时间访问时,看到的是最新且一致的内容

     4.SEO优化:搜索引擎爬虫也遵循缓存机制,合理管理缓存有助于搜索引擎更快地抓取并索引网站内容

     如何查看网页缓存文件 1. 浏览器开发者工具 几乎所有现代浏览器都内置了强大的开发者工具,其中就包括缓存查看功能

    以Chrome为例: - 打开Chrome浏览器,按F12或右键点击页面选择“检查”打开开发者工具

     - 切换到“Network”标签页,重新加载页面以捕获网络请求

     - 筛选并查看“Size”列下带有“(fromcache)”或类似标识的请求,这些即为缓存命中的资源

     - 点击任一请求,在右侧的“Response”或“Preview”标签页中可查看缓存文件的实际内容

     2. 浏览器缓存目录 虽然直接访问浏览器缓存目录不如开发者工具直观,但在某些特定场景下(如离线分析)仍有其价值

    不同操作系统和浏览器缓存位置各异,一般可通过浏览器设置或搜索引擎查询具体路径

     3. 使用专业工具 对于复杂场景,如分析大量缓存文件或需要深度挖掘缓存行为,可以使用专业的网络分析工具,如Wireshark、Fiddler等

    这些工具能够捕获并详细分析网络流量,包括缓存请求与响应

     缓存策略与管理 - 合理设置HTTP缓存头:通过`Cache-Control`、`Expires`等HTTP头部指令,精确控制资源的缓存策略

     - 利用CDN加速:CDN节点遍布全球,能有效减少用户到服务器的距离,同时CDN也提供了丰富的缓存管理功能

     - 定期清理缓存:避免过时内容影响用户体验,可设定自动或手动缓存清理策略

     - 用户端缓存管理:通过JavaScript等前端技术,引导用户清除浏览器缓存或提供版本控制策略,确保用户看到最新内容

     结语 查看网页缓存文件是优化网站性能、保障内容一致性及提升用户体验的重要手段

    通过合理利用浏览器开发者工具、了解缓存管理机制以及采取科学的缓存策略,我们能够更加精准地掌握网页缓存的运作情况,从而为网站的长远发展奠定坚实基础

    在这个快速变化的数字世界里,掌握这些技能,无疑将使我们更具竞争力